Dumas-bulb technique

In the Dumas-bulb technique for determining the molar mass of an unknown liquid, you vaporize the sample of a liquid that boils below 100 °C in a boiling-water bath and determine the mass of vapor required to fill the bulb (see drawing, next page). From the following data, calculate the molar mass of the unknown liquid mass of unknown vapor, 1.012 g volume of bulb, 354 cm pressure, 742 torr temperature, 99 "C. [Pg.418]
